Abstract
Ximenia americana is among wild edible fruit indigenous to Ethiopia. The fruit reported as indispensable source of phytochemicals and health imparting components. However, the phytochemicals constituents, antioxidant activities and fatty acid profile of Ethiopian X. americana cultivar studies are still scarce. This research aimed at evaluation of flesh and seed of Ethiopian X. americana yellow and red colored cultivars for bioactive component, antioxidant activities, fatty acid profiles and physicochemical characteristics. The red fruit flesh had higher total phenol (3292.60 mg GAE/100 g) while yellow fruit flesh showed higher total flavonoid (173.95 mg quercetin/100g). The higher DPPH∗ radical scavenging activity (97%) was observed in red fruit flesh due to its higher phenolic content. The yellow X. americana seed (90.69 mg QE/100g) had higher total flavonoid contents than the red seed (18.64 mg QE/100g). The dominant unsaturated fatty acid found in red X. americana flesh was oleic acid (26.29%), and the main saturated fatty acid detected was palmitic acid (29.78%). The seed also had high unsaturated fatty acid which was elaidic acid, (84.32%). Ximeninic acid (12.78%) which is expected to be detected in Ximenia americana seed oil was also observed. The highest content of fat (52.23%) and protein (16.59%) was obtained in yellow fruit seed and the lowest fat content observed in yellow flesh (7.25%). Most abundant minerals were calcium (42.45-49.55 mg/100g) and manganese (26.73-33.92 mg/100g) in seeds. Whereas, fleshs displayed higher magnesium (76.3-98.27 mg/100g) and copper (1.35-1.52 mg/100g) contents. The Ethiopian X. americana fruit cultivars represent high nutritional and medicinal values despite variation related to genetic variability.Entities:

Total phenol and flavonoid content of two cultivars of X. americana fruit.
| Parameters | Red | Yellow | ||
|---|---|---|---|---|
| Seed | Flesh | Seed | Flesh | |
| Total Phenol (mg GAE/100 g) | 704.31 ± 19.84c | 3292.60 ± 259.21a | 544.04 ± 34.56d | 2880.39 ± 198.49b |
| Total Flavonoid (mg QE/100 g) | 18.64 ± 4.27d | 58.34 ± 6.62c | 90.69 ± 7.57b | 173.95 ± 8.24a |
The same letters in the same row represents no significant difference (P < 0.05). All values are expressed as mean ± standard deviation (n = 3).

Fatty acid composition (%) of flesh and seed of the red X. americana fruit cultivar.
| Retention time (min) | Systematic name | Common name | Chemical formula | Flesh | Seed |
|---|---|---|---|---|---|
| 10.59 | Nonadecane | Nonadecane | C19H40 | 6.36 | ND |
| 11.44 | Hexadecanoic acid, methyl ester | Palmitic acid methyl ester | C17H34O2 | 29.78 | 1.18 |
| 11.54 | 2-Chloro-N-(hydroxymethyl)acetamide | Chloracetamide-N-methanol | C3H6ClNO2 | 1.77 | ND |
| 13.32 | 9-Octadecenoic acid (Z)-, methyl ester | Oleic acid, methyl ester | C19H36O2 | 26.29 | ND |
| 13.30 | 9-Octadecenoic acid, methyl ester (E) | Elaidic acid, methyl ester | C19H36O2 | ND | 84.32 |
| 13.38 | Octadecane, 2,6,10,14-tetramethyl | 2,6,10,14-Tetramethyloctadecane | C22H46 | 16.29 | ND |
| 13.47 | Methyl stearate | stearic acid, methyl ester | C19H38O2 | 8.18 | 1.72 |
| 14.72 | Bis(2-ethylhexyl) phthalate | Diethylhexylphthalate | C24H38O4 | 11.33 | ND |
| 15.33 | Methyl octadeca-9-yn-11-trans-enoic acid | Ximeninic acid | C18H30O2 | ND | 12.78 |
| TSFA | - | - | - | 73.71 | 2.9 |
| TUFA | - | - | - | 26.29 | 97.1 |
ND - Not detected. TSFA - Total saturated fatty acid; TUFA- Total unsaturated fatty acids.
Chemical composition of red and yellow X. americana fruit cultivar expressed in dry weight basis except moisture.
| Chemical compositions | Red | Yellow | ||
|---|---|---|---|---|
| Seed | Flesh | Seed | Flesh | |
| Moisture (% fw) | 15.62 ± 0.60b | 68 ± 0.59a | 14.09 ± 0.49b | 71 ± 0.70a |
| Crude fat (%) | 49.58 ± 0.37b | 7.78 ± 0.31c | 52.23 ± 0.43a | 7.25 ± 0.33c |
| Total Nitrogen | 2.39 ± 0.31b | 1.65 ± 0.25c | 2.65 ± 0.41a | 1.77 ± 0.23c |
| Crude protein ( | 14.96 ± 1.34b | 10.32 ± 1.35c | 16.59 ± 2.25a | 11.11 ± 1.52c |
| Crude fiber (%) | 28.09 ± 1.34a | 5.58 ± 0.51b | 25.22 ± 1.93a | 4.41 ± 0.80b |
| Ash (%) | 1.45 ± 0.23c | 7.83 ± 0.25a | 1.32 ± 0.22c | 7.02 ± 0.22b |
| pH | 4.91 ± 0.1a | 2.84 ± 0.01b | 4.79 ± 0.09a | 2.75 ± 0.01c |
| Total soluble solid | ND | 26.82 ± 3.01a | ND | 25.57 ± 1.51a |
The same letters in the same row represents no significant difference (P < 0.05). All values are expressed as mean ± standard deviation (n = 3). fw - fresh weight.
ND: Not determined.
Mineral composition of seed and flesh of X. americana fruit (expressed on mg/100 g) of Sample.
| Fruit parts | Calcium | Magnesium | Iron | Manganese | Copper |
|---|---|---|---|---|---|
| Red flesh | 16.56 ± 2.08d | 98.27 ± 11.02a | 2.16 ± 13a | 0.74 ± 09c | 1.35 ± 04ab |
| Red seed | 49.55 ± 6.9a | 32.64 ± 4.0d | 1.15 ± 0.05b | 33.92 ± 0.58a | 0.083 ± 0.09c |
| Yellow flesh | 23.14 ± 1.8c | 76.3 ± 5.19b | 1.74 ± 0.8a | 1.07 ± 0.35c | 1.52 ± 0.02a |
| Yellow seed | 42.45 ± 14b | 41 ± 288c | 1.29 ± 0.01b | 26.73 ± 7.08b | 0.10 ± 0.5bc |
Means followed by the same letters in the same column for each part of the fruit do not differ by Tukey's test at 5% probability. All values are expressed as mean ± standard deviation (n = 3).
